Barbara's Story

Okay, so you want a little history? Wow!! This past Memorial Day weekend I found out how some classmates remember me...and yes, I was surprised. One even thought I was "quiet" - another squealed at that idea!! I began college about 3 weeks after graduation, then worked and went to school; married/moved to FL for the next 20 years (BA/Accounting); had one son; divorced and moved to AR!! Yea, that was a cultural SHOCK! Met and married a guy from CA; moved to LA where I returned to school for Psych and Healthcare Finance. (Here we go again)...divorced and moved to TN. Oh, let's just say, I liked divorce so much I did it again!!! Met the love of my life in TN (he's from AR); we married 17 years ago and lived in MS (surprise!!) just across the TN border at Memphis. There I upgraded my interest in politics..and served on the city council for 8 years. During that time my love was diagnosed with cancer. We began traveling to Houston for stem cell transplant (1998) and treatment since. After a 13-month stay in 03&04 we decided to buy a home here and return behind the Mayflower Van. home than moving to a new city! I retired in June, 2002, and finished my court cases in December. Yes, I miss my career to this day - but I LOVE not setting an alarm clock and everyday can be Saturday if I so wish!! I've donated time to help M.D.Anderson Cancer Center fight for patients' benefits with Medicare (my field of work), and of course, we spend a lot of time there anyway! Along the way, I became a grandmother to twin girls (now 18) and a wonderful grandson (age 12). The sad part is they live in Florida, and we don't get to see them very often due to my husband's illness. He's doing rather well; has chemo, etc. to stay in remission (Myeloma: bone marrow cancer), which is incurable but with God's Grace and prayers from many people we have a very good life. Please keep us in your prayers. Chairing the 2008 50th high school graduation anniversary for my class gave me the opportunity to contact many people I'd not heard from or of for 50 years. Thank you for giving me many months of fond memories - and whether you made it to the reunion or not - you gave me a reunion with those wonderful memories. May 2009 be a great year for all of us!
